Parks director asks Nueces County to consider $600,000 encumbrance for pavilion, habitat monitoring adds unexpected cost

Nueces County Commissioners Court · June 8, 2012

Parks department staff presented a revised budget to the Nueces County Commissioners Court, proposing to encumber $600,000 from its $1.44 million fund balance for capital improvements — including renovating Briscoe King Pavilion — and warned a new Army Corps permit creates habitat-monitoring costs of roughly $21,000 the first year.

Scott, a parks department staff member, asked the Nueces County Commissioners Court to consider encumbering $600,000 from the department—s fund balance to pay for capital improvements, saying the work would produce measurable returns and reduce reliance on the county general fund.

Scott told the court his department—s fund balance stands at $1,443,003 and proposed adding $450,000 to an existing $150,000 contingency appropriation to create a $600,000 capital pool for projects such as renovating the Briscoe King Pavilion, upgrading pier concession kitchen facilities and improving RV-park amenities.

Scott said the pavilion renovation is projected conservatively to generate about $75,600 in additional annual revenue, modeled as one weekly meeting (52 meetings a year) at current demand levels.
